Abstract

A kind of laser welding streamline for the welding of condenser support body, including rotation platform and fixing device, rotation platform outer ring is provided with the laser-beam welding machine for welding, circular orbit is provided with below rotation platform, rotation platform side is provided with roller, circular orbit inwall is provided with ring gear, and the side of rotation platform is fixed with motor, and gear is connected with by reductor on motor;Fixing device includes one group of location-plate being rotatably connected on vertically on rotation platform, and location-plate front end face is provided with locating slot, and location-plate edge is provided with clamping device, and locating slot locating surface is provided with groove.The utility model has the advantages that:It is of the present utility model rational in infrastructure, compact, engaged by gear, the rotation of rotation platform is set to realize that location-plate revolves round the sun, and location-plate is sent in front of laser-beam welding machine be processed using the rotation of location-plate, realize Continuous maching of the laser-beam welding machine to multiple condenser positive and negatives, welding production efficiency is greatly improved, using effect is good, suitable for promoting.

Laser welding streamline for the welding of condenser support body
Technical field
Welding connection technology field, more particularly to a kind of laser welding streamline are the utility model is related to, is specifically a kind of use In the laser welding streamline of condenser support body welding.
Background technology
Laser welder technology is fast-developing at present, because its welding is rapidly and efficiently and pollution-free, more and more process units Welding job is carried out using laser-beam welding machine, and the installation frame body of condenser is using undoubtedly substantially increasing production after laser welding Efficiency, but present condenser welding completes one still by condenser bodies and installation frame body as in a fixed platform Reverse side welding is dismantled again after the welding in face, this welding manner largely constrains the processing efficiency of laser welding, can not The advantage of laser welding is played, also reduces the welding efficiency of condenser, it is now desired to which one kind can make laser-beam welding machine quickly double The streamline of face welding plays the advantage of laser-beam welding machine.
Utility model content
The utility model will solve the above-mentioned problems of the prior art, there is provided a kind of swashing for the welding of condenser support body Photocoagulation streamline, solve the problems, such as that current condenser installation frame body welding efficiency is low, meet the needs of improving welding efficiency.
The utility model solves the technical scheme of its technical problem use:This Laser Welding for the welding of condenser support body Streamline, including rotation platform and fixing device are connect, rotation platform outer ring is provided with the laser-beam welding machine for welding, rotation platform Lower section is provided with circular orbit, and rotation platform side corner is evenly distributed with one group of roller coordinated with circular orbit, circular orbit Inwall is provided with the ring gear surrounded by arc rack, and the side of rotation platform is fixed with motor, passed through on motor Reductor is connected with and ring gear meshed gears.After so setting, motor drives pinion rotation, and gear is nibbled with ring gear Merging is moved to drive the rotation of whole rotation platform using the roller on rotation platform on circular orbit.
Fixing device includes one group of location-plate being rotatably connected on vertically on rotation platform, and location-plate front end face is provided with fixed The locating slot of position installation condenser, is provided with clamping device, clamping device gos deep into including front end around the location-plate edge of locating slot It is used for briquetting of the top pressure on condenser in locating slot, locating slot locating surface, which is provided with, extends through the logical of positioning back Groove, the welding position on groove face condenser rear end face.After so setting, the rotation of rotation platform realizes the public affairs of location-plate Turn, location-plate can be sent to the front of laser-beam welding machine, and control location-plate rotation to realize positive and negative towards laser-beam welding machine, Condenser is positioned by positional operand, condenser is fixed by the briquetting on clamping device, groove provides Laser Welding Pick the passage welded in positioning back, and such laser-beam welding machine can connects to the positive and negative of multiple condensers Continuous welding, greatly improves welding efficiency, realizes two-sided welding.
As further improvement of the utility model, location-plate even circumferential is arranged on rotation platform, on rotation platform Provided with, from turntable, being rotatably connected to rotating shaft from turntable, the rotating shaft first half is fixed on the rear end face of location-plate with auto-lock function. Location-plate has multiple circumference to be arranged on rotation platform, and multiple location-plates can once weld multiple condensers, can improve welding Efficiency, location-plate is set to realize rotation by rotating shaft from turntable, you can so that towards laser-beam welding machine, the positive and negative of location-plate is entered into one Step improves welding efficiency.
As further improvement of the utility model, clamping device is located at the left and right and upside of locating slot, left and right respectively Both sides clamping device top pressure is in the left and right ends of condenser, and upside clamping device top pressure is at the top of condenser.Condenser bottom surface Against the bottom surface of locating slot, clamping device distinguishes top pressure in the left and right and upside of condenser, realize it is comprehensive be fixedly clamped, Ensure that condenser is in fixed state, make welding quality more preferable.
As further improvement of the utility model, clamping device is included by cylinder, before briquetting is fixed on the push rod of cylinder End.Promoting briquetting top pressure using the push rod of cylinder, simple and convenient, top pressure significant effect, using effect is good on condenser.
As further improvement of the utility model, the upper surface of roller and circular orbit coordinates, and footpath is provided with the inside of roller To annular nib, annular nib is stuck in the inwall side of circular orbit, annular groove offered in circular orbit end face outside, rotates The limited roller being vertically arranged in annular groove, limited roller and limit of the top pressure on rotation platform above and below roller are connected with platform Bit architecture.Horizontal limiting is played a part of in the inwall side that annular nib is stuck in circular orbit, and limited roller pushes up up and down with roller The position limiting structure being pressed on rotation platform then plays effect spacing up and down, and which ensures that the stabilization of whole rotation platform operating Property and continuity, for welding advantage is provided.
As further improvement of the utility model, circular orbit top boss has a raised track, and roller appearance is inward-facing It is recessed and coordinates with raised track.Raised track and roller, which cave in, is partially submerged into cooperation, without extra structure, has both strengthened rotation Turn the mating connection relation of platform and circular orbit, reach the spacing purpose to rotation platform again.
As further improvement of the utility model, locating slot locating surface is provided with some locating pieces, and locating piece coordinates fixed Position is in the both sides of condenser or so header into clamping structure.Locating piece is used for the positioning to condenser bodies, is easy to subsequently press from both sides The fixation work of tight device, locating piece is respectively positioned at condenser collecting pipe both sides and by header clamping and positioning.
As further improvement of the utility model, motor, controlled between turntable and laser-beam welding machine by PLC Connection.PLC controls motor, the cooperation operating between turntable and laser-beam welding machine, realize that quick joining is processed, improve certainly Dynamicization coordinates efficiency.
Using the technique of this laser welding streamline welded for condenser support body, its step is:
A:Condenser is made up of condenser bodies and the installation frame body being fixed at left and right sides of condenser bodies, by condenser Main body is installed in locating slot and positioned, and the briquetting top pressure on clamping device is manual in condenser bodies, then by installation frame body Pressing is fitted on the two-side current collecting pipe of condenser bodies, and then the briquetting top pressure on the clamping device of both sides is in installation frame body On, repeat above-mentioned action and be fixed to until by condenser on all location-plates.
B:Motor drive gear rotates, and gear engages with ring gear and drives rotation platform to start to rotate, rotating While platform rotates, location-plate also begins to rotate, front and location-plate until location-plate unitary rotation to laser-beam welding machine Front end also face laser-beam welding machine.
C:The plumb joint alignment condenser bodies and installation frame body front end face junction, laser-beam welding machine of laser-beam welding machine are opened Beginning carries out welding to upper 1/4 section and lower 1/4 section of left and right sides junction and forms welding section, completes front end face welding job.
D:Location-plate, which starts 180 ° of rotations, makes positioning back face laser-beam welding machine, and laser-beam welding machine is through groove to the back of the body Upper 1/4 section and lower 1/4 section of junction carries out welding and forms welding section at left and right sides of face, and rear end face welding is completed.
E:After the welding job for completing a condenser, drive gear rotates rotation platform to motor again, and second The step of block location-plate rotates simultaneously, makes second piece of condenser front end face laser-beam welding machine, and laser-beam welding machine repeats C and D is entered Row welding.
F:Above-mentioned action is repeated until the condenser in all fixed plates completes welding job.
